Home
All countries
Contact us.
You are here :
Main page
»
Ecuador
» Machachi, Pichincha, Ecuador
Your Location
Latitude :
-0.5100000
Longitude :
-78.5700000
Elevation :
Sponsored Links
Altitude of Machachi, Pichincha, Ecuador
Mejia
Altitude :